There are many public providers to choose from when it comes to cloud computing. So, how do you know which one to select for your organization? This course examines industry-leading public cloud platforms and compares the services and features offered by each. Join instructor David Linthicum as he provides a deeper look at the “big three”: Amazon Web Services, Microsoft Azure, and Google Cloud Platform, as well as a brief overview of other leading platforms, including Oracle, IBM, and Alibaba. Learn the fundamentals of public cloud solutions, consider reasons why you might switch your business to a public cloud or clouds, and discover the features and services offered by several providers—from security to integration and compatibility features.
